The Critical Risk of Neglecting Antivirus on Network Shares
I've seen way too many organizations brush off basic security protocols when it comes to network shares. Honestly, using shared resources without enabling antivirus software to scan those files is like leaving your front door wide open and then throwing a party. You just can't afford to overlook the risks that come with it. Various types of malware thrive in shared network environments, and it's alarming how often people assume that just because they're behind a corporate firewall, they're safe. You need to realize that network shares can be a breeding ground for ransomware, viruses, and even zero-day exploits, which can quickly spiral out of control if not addressed.
I can't emphasize enough that shared drives are not just a convenient way to transfer files; they're a potential attack surface. I've seen some colleagues say, "Oh, we have a good IT policy, it probably covers antivirus." Spoiler alert: just saying that doesn't make it true. If your organization uses a shared network drive, you are inviting malicious code directly into your environment if you aren't scanning those files. The downside can be catastrophic, with infected files potentially spreading throughout your entire network.
One of the most common and easily overlooked scenarios occurs when a team member unwittingly uploads a compromised file to a shared folder. Without an antivirus scan in place, that file is now accessible to everyone who has access to that network share. Once it's in the wild, what do you think happens? Employees may unknowingly execute that file, leading to increased chances of infection affecting not just the original machine, but also every device that connects to the network.
I've been in situations where organizations believe that their security measures are sufficient simply because they've implemented standard firewalls and intrusion detection systems. The truth is, these tools are good, but they absolutely do not replace the necessity for an active antivirus presence. Firewalls monitor incoming and outgoing traffic, while intrusion detection can alert you to threats, but they don't actively inspect files. That's specifically where antivirus software steps in, acting as your first line of defense against harmful files.
Incorporating antivirus scanning into your shared network drives not only protects your organization from immediate threats but also acts as a deterrent. Script kiddies and cybercriminals often look for easy targets. If they see that your network shares are guarded by antivirus measures, they might just move on to targeting a less secure environment. This act alone can save you countless hours, dollars, and headaches in the long run. You don't want to be the organization that's in the news because of a devastating malware attack resulting from an easily preventable situation.
Real-World Consequences of Ignoring Antivirus Protection
If you think ignoring antivirus software on network shares is low risk, I encourage you to examine some real-world incidents. Just a couple of months ago, I read about a local business that suffered a ransomware attack because someone uploaded an infected PDF to a shared folder. They thought that restricting access to the folder was enough security, but what they failed to realize was that access control alone can't eliminate the risk of file-based attacks. Once that PDF was opened by another team member, the malicious code spread like wildfire, locking everyone out of important files and leading to significant downtime.
Which reminds me-downtime isn't just a pesky inconvenience; it's detrimental to your revenue and reputation. The organization not only had to invest heavily in recovering their information but also lost business during the outage. Their IT team scrambled to filter through hundreds of infected systems, trying to isolate the damage while productivity plummeted. Just imagine being in their shoes, and realizing that all of this chaos stemmed from a single, unscanned file.
It's not always ransomware, either. I recently read about a company that got hit by a remote access Trojan through an unscanned shared file. Once installed, the malware created backdoors for the attackers who could then remotely steal sensitive data. This is particularly alarming because you're exposing confidential company files to attackers without even knowing it. Data breaches can incur monumental legal fees, not to mention the potential fines from regulatory bodies for failing to maintain proper cybersecurity standards.
Nobody wants to be the story that's shared in IT seminars about what not to do. Psychologically, being known as 'that company' creates an incalculable amount of damage to your brand. Yet, ignoring fundamental practices like antivirus scanning can propel you right into that pitfall. It's like playing poker and deciding to forgo the rules-you may win for a while, but eventually, the house always wins.
Some organizations have tried to argue that implementing antivirus software slows down file transfers and reduces performance on their network shares. However, I find that argument utterly baseless. With the right configurations and updates, modern antivirus tools offer minimal impact on system performance while delivering powerful scanning capabilities. You have to weigh the slight performance drop against the immense risk of file infections spreading through your network. There's just no contest.
Let's not forget how frequently software updates are released. Malware becomes more sophisticated as time goes on, so even if an antivirus tool was sufficient last month, it might not be enough today. If you're relying on outdated security measures, you're essentially composing an invitation for breaches to occur. Regularly updating your antivirus software means that it can adapt to new threats, ensuring that your organization remains protected at all times. With how rapidly malware evolves, it's almost a crime to operate without a solid antivirus strategy in place.
The Dynamics of Team Collaboration and Security Risks
In any business environment, collaboration is crucial, and shared network drives often serve as the backbone for teamwork. But with that collaborative spirit, you also introduce a mixed bag of risks. Consider how many people have access to any given shared folder. If you have even a single employee who isn't versed in good cybersecurity practices, that presents a vulnerability. You could have the most advanced firewalls in the world, but they won't help you when someone opens a risky file from an untrusted source.
It's easy to forget that human error accounts for a significant percentage of security breaches. Imagine a new intern working on a group project who accidentally uploads an infected file they downloaded from a sketchy website. Before they even realize it, that file has been distributed to everyone who shares access to the network drive. You've turned your collaborative setup into a potential cyber minefield.
You might think formal training on security protocols would minimize the chances of such incidents. Maybe it would, but there's no magic bullet for human error. Instead, create safety nets. Regular antivirus scans should be one of those nets. In doing so, you add another layer to your security framework that can catch errors before they escalate into full-blown issues.
Some companies deploy additional layers of protection by using file integrity checks. While incorporating those measures can absolutely enhance security, they're not substitutes for active antivirus scanning. Both methods work best in tandem; the checks ensure file integrity, while the antivirus software serves as a more proactive measure. You have to be prepared for a multi-faceted approach to file security if you want to minimize risks across shared drives.
Active monitoring is another crucial aspect. If you're an IT professional in a larger organization, you probably already know that active surveillance mechanisms can alert you to abnormal activities. Implementing an antivirus solution that supports real-time monitoring adds another vital function to your arsenal. If a file starts to behave suspiciously, you want your systems to notify you before it spreads or causes damage.
It's human nature to want to act quickly when collaborating with teams. If someone in your group has a file they need to share, they may rush to do so without considering the implications. Implementing antivirus scans on shared drives creates friction that can feel inconvenient but accomplishes the much larger goal of keeping the environment secure. Accept that short-term speed bumps can lead to long-term gains in security and overall productivity down the line.
